I made a square card for encouragement (event). My trends are Watercolor, Stencils and Sequins. Using a stencil and water color paper, I sponged distress ink over the stencil. Then I lightly sprayed water through the stencil. I blotted the paper with a paper towel before removing the stencil, after which I used a heat tool to dry the paper. I cut it down to fit my 5x5 card front. The image is colored with Spectrum Noirs and cut with a scalloped oval Nestie die. I inked the edges of the die before popping it up on the card front.
